Telugu has a complete set of letters that follow a system to express sounds. The script is derived from the [[Brahmi script]] like those of many other Indian languages.<ref name="bot">[[:te:దస్త్రం:Telugulipi evolution.jpg]]</ref><ref>{{cite book |last=Austin |first=Peter |url=https://books.google.com/books?id=Q3tAqIU0dPsC&dq=Telugu+Brahmi+script&pg=PA117 |title=One Thousand Languages: Living, Endangered, and Lost |date=2008 |publisher=University of California Press |isbn=978-0-520-25560-9 |page=117 |language=en |author-link=Peter Austin (linguist)}}</ref> Telugu script is written from left to right and comprises sequences of both simple and complex characters. It is syllabic in nature – the basic units of writing are syllables. Inasmuch as the number of possible syllables is very large, syllables are composed of more basic units such as vowels ("''acchu''" or "''swaram''") and consonants ("''hallu''" or "''vyanjanam''"). Consonants in consonant clusters take shapes that are very different from the shapes they take elsewhere. Consonants are presumed pure consonants, that is, without any vowel sound in them. However, it is traditional to write and read consonants with an implied "a" vowel sound. When consonants combine with other vowel signs, the vowel part is indicated orthographically using signs known as vowel "''mātras''". The shapes of vowel "''mātras''" are also very different from the shapes of the corresponding vowels. Historically, a sentence used to end with either a single bar। ("''pūrna virāmam''") or a double bar॥ ("''dīrgha virāmam''"); in handwriting, Telugu words were not separated by spaces.
